
This lavishly illustrated book is the first architectural history of one of Oxford's most famous colleges. The contributors discuss the foundation of the college, the construction of its medieval buildings, its neo-gothic expansion, the work of Nicholas Hawksmoor, and the changes that have occurred in the 18th and 19th centuries.
